Mobileme has a mail service too?

I mean, like Gmail.
IMAP based push email, calendar, contacts, bookmarks, photo galleries, 20GB storage space and remote tools for your iPhone (phone locator, remote wipe, etc).

Works on PCs and Mac. I use it with Outlook on my Dell and on my iPhone. All my email is instantly sync'd, along with calendars, contacts and everything else I listed above.

The catch is I don't think it will work with other phones. I mean, you don't have to use a phone to use it, but if you did, it would have to be an iPhone.

The Gmail thing is cool though. $50 is a pretty good price for that.

Edit: I don't get the storage stuff though. Google gives 25GB of email storage, but nothing for regular file storage? MobileMe has 20GB of empty storage space that you access in Windows Explorer (or Finder) and drag and drop whatever you want to.
